Twitter just for the worse. The service has apparently been infected by a worm from the site owners StalkDaily
(Note: do not visit this site, because it can cause your computer to be infected).
At this point, details are scarce, but it seems to visit an infected user's Twitter profile can bring your profile to become infected (some reports say that the worm changes its 'About Me' section to include a link to the worm). Infected people may start to spam tweets sometimes refer users to the website StalkDaily.

Update on StalkDaily.com Worm 36 minutes ago
Today we were informed of a site "evil" that has been the spread of connections on Twitter StalkDaily.com without consent through a cross-site scripting vulnerability. We have taken steps to remove the offending updates, and to close the holes that allowed this "worm to spread.N. passwords, phone numbers or other sensitive information have been compromised as part of this attack.
